We will reach the first destination of this tour, the municipality of Temozon where the hubiku cenote is located being our first point to visit.

We will reach the first destination of this tour, the Cenote Hubiku which is located in the village of Temozón very close to the city of Valladolid and the Archaeological Zone of Chichen Itza, its name can be interpreted in the Mayan language as “The great lord or nest of iguanas”.

In Hubiku you can swim in the crystal clear waters and watch the light pass through and touch the water, creating indescribable glows while listening to the singing of the birds that welcome visitors.

The Chichen Itza Light Show. Known as Kukulkán Nights; this light and sound show allows us for a few years to visit at night this important archaeological area. Kukulkan Nights shows us with a spectacular play of lights and sound the Mayan story. Moving images projected onto the impressive pyramid that tell us stories of gods and humans; rites, customs, knowledge of the cosmos and mathematics.

A must do in Mexico - This is a long trip from Cancun. Pickup was 9am and dropped off at home hotel was 2:30am. Over 18 hours total. Keep this in mind. Well worth the cost. Eduardo was excellent tour guide. The cenote was great and so was the restaurant. Would have been nice to shorten the time at cenote and given to stop at town to browse. The night show is a must see. The only disappointment was there was no translation for the Spanish narration. Would be nice if there was an App to download on your smart phone and listen to translation via a headset. Also be wary of the flying beatles during the show. Apparently the projector behind us spectators attracts them. Show up there at least 60-80 people ahead of you because seating is assigned to first come. I give this tip because the beatles come flying towards the light projector behind us spectators and the first 4 rows get bombarded by these flying beatles and those people in front of you deflect them from getting towards the back rows.
